BLUESIL Paste M494 (200 g) – Thermally conductive silicone paste (200 g) for electronic cooling
BLUESIL Paste M494 is a thermally conductive silicone paste available in a convenient 200-gram container for use in workshops and maintenance applications. Optimized for heat transfer between electronic components and heat sinks.
Typical applications
- Thermal paste for electronic components
- Thermal Interface Material (TIM) with improved thermal conductivity
- Maintenance and Repair of Heat Dissipation Systems
Properties and Specifications
| container | 200-g tube (for workshop use) |
| thermal conductivity | approx. 1.0 W/m·K |
| Operating temperature | −40°C to +200°C |
| Shelf Life | 36 months |
storage
Store in unopened original packaging at 2–40°C for up to 36 months. Keep in a cool, dry place, away from sources of ignition.

Silicone-based greases and pastes are significantly more thermally stable (up to +200°C vs. ~150°C for mineral oil), chemically inert, hydrophobic, and do not form resins as they age. However, they are more expensive. They are suitable for applications where long-term performance is required under extreme temperatures or in chemically aggressive environments.
No. Silicone greases should never be mixed with mineral oil-based or synthetic greases. The thickening agents are different, and mixing them can cause clumping or reduce lubricating performance. Clean the system thoroughly before switching.
